> Instead of worrying about types, why not worry about the actual code quality?

I'd argue that a sign of good code quality is using types even in languages and contexts where you don't have to.

PHP is technically still a duck-typed language, but the community has embraced its relatively new strict typing features with open arms and the PHP ecosystem is all the much better for it.
